<p>Hi,</p>
<p>We're using modified novarc generated by nova-manage without keystone.<br>
I'm not sure that nova-manage works well with keystone but parhaps it can't. <br>
So we registered some users and credentials to keystone, and modified EC_* variables in novarc to fit them.</p>
<p>I think that we have to make nova-manage working with keystone if it couldn't.</p>
<p>Regards,<br>
  A. Yoshiyama<br>
  NEC Corp., Japan<br>
</p>
<div class="gmail_quote">2011/10/13 23:58 "David Kranz" <<a href="mailto:david.kranz@qrclab.com">david.kranz@qrclab.com</a>>:<br type="attribution"><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">

  
    
  
  <div bgcolor="#FFFFFF" text="#000000">
    OK, thanks. I guess that was a problem I was going to run into next.
    But how do you generate the EC2_*  shell variables that euca tools
    need when using keystone? With the old nova auth this was done with
    'nova-manage project zipfile' but that does not work with keystone
    because there are no longer users in the nova database. Am I missing
    something?<br>
    <br>
     -David<br>
    <br>
    <br>
    On 10/13/2011 9:21 AM, Akira Yoshiyama wrote:
    <blockquote type="cite">
      <p>Hi,</p>
      <p>We are testing nova, glance, swift and keystone of diablo
        release now.<br>
        You can use nova + keystone with euca-tools if you applied a
        patch for two bugs in keystone/middleware/ec2_token.py that I
        reported.<br>
        But there is no official keystone fileter for swift3 (S3 API for
        swift). So, you can't use swift + keystone with euca-tools.</p>
      <p>Today I wrote a s3-token keystone filter and patches for
        keystone and swift3. We can upload images to keystoned swift
        with euca-upload-bundle.</p>
      <p>Regards,<br>
          A. Yoshiyama <br>
          NEC, Japan<br>
          <a href="mailto:akirayoshiyama@gmail.com" target="_blank">akirayoshiyama@gmail.com</a></p>
      <div class="gmail_quote">2011/10/13 5:45 "David Kranz" <<a href="mailto:david.kranz@qrclab.com" target="_blank">david.kranz@qrclab.com</a>>:<br type="attribution">
        <bl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
          Using "devstack" (thank you!) made it easy to see how the
          keystone/nova integration was supposed to work and how to use
          nova client to create vms, etc. In this case the old method of
          using nova-manage to create users and then zipping up
          credentials to use with euca tools is not possible. Is there,
          or is their going to be, a way to use euca-tools with keystone
          in place?<br>
          <br>
          <br>
          <br>
          _______________________________________________<br>
          Mailing list: <a href="https://launchpad.net/%7Eopenstack" target="_blank">https://launchpad.net/~openstack</a><br>
          Post to     : <a href="mailto:openstack@lists.launchpad.net" target="_blank">openstack@lists.launchpad.net</a><br>
          Unsubscribe : <a href="https://launchpad.net/%7Eopenstack" target="_blank">https://launchpad.net/~openstack</a><br>
          More help   : <a href="https://help.launchpad.net/ListHelp" target="_blank">https://help.launchpad.net/ListHelp</a><br>
        </blockquote>
      </div>
    </blockquote>
    <br>
  </div>

</blockquote></div>